Description

【考案の詳細な説明】 この考案は、内幅木用のタイル素地に関する。[Detailed explanation of the idea] This invention relates to a tile base for internal baseboards.

従来、内幅木用の素地を施釉した後、それらを匣鉢に詰
めて焼成した際、以上の様な欠点があった。
Conventionally, when base materials for inner baseboards were glazed and then packed into saggers and fired, there were the above-mentioned drawbacks.

以下、内幅本製造の場合を例に採って第1図に基づいて
説明する。
Hereinafter, an explanation will be given based on FIG. 1, taking as an example the case of manufacturing a book of inner width.

陶磁製、セメント製9合戊樹脂製。金属製等の内幅木用
の素地1は、平坦部2とその1側辺に連なる平坦部2に
対して90°近く湾曲した湾曲部3とより構成されてい
る。
Made of ceramic, cement, 9-ply resin. A base material 1 for an inner skirting board made of metal or the like is composed of a flat part 2 and a curved part 3 that is curved at nearly 90 degrees with respect to the flat part 2 and connected to one side of the flat part 2.

この明細書において、湾曲部とは、その先端に平坦部を
有する湾曲部をも含む。
In this specification, a curved portion includes a curved portion having a flat portion at its tip.

該素地1は、素焼された後又はそのままで、その表面4
を上に向けた状態でコンベヤに載せられ、コンベヤで移
動する間に、その表面4及び湾曲部3の先端面3aに一
様にかつ自動的に釉薬5が施される。
The base material 1 has a surface 4 after being bisque fired or as it is.
The glaze 5 is placed on the conveyor with the surface facing upward, and the glaze 5 is uniformly and automatically applied to the surface 4 and the tip surface 3a of the curved portion 3 while being moved on the conveyor.

次いで、湾曲部3の先端面3aに付着している釉薬5を
ローラ等で払拭し、各2枚の素地1の施釉面(表面)4
同志を向かい合わせるようにすると共に、湾曲部3の先
端面3a同志を突き合わせるようにして対となして匣鉢
内に収めて、焼成するのである。
Next, the glaze 5 adhering to the tip surface 3a of the curved portion 3 is wiped off with a roller or the like, and the glazed surface (surface) 4 of each of the two substrates 1 is removed.
They are placed in a pair so that they face each other and the tip surfaces 3a of the curved portions 3 are butted against each other, and are housed in a sagger and fired.

上記の如く湾曲部3の先端面3aの釉薬5を払拭するの
は、先端面3aに釉薬5が付着しておれば、釉薬5が表
面張力等の働きにより、画先端面3aに跨った状態とな
り、かかる状態で焼成されるため焼成された釉薬5によ
り画素地1が先端面3aで連結状態となり、そのため焼
成完了複画素地1を引き離さなければならないが、その
際、連結状態の釉薬の破損が湾曲部3の釉薬5の層にも
及ぶことが多かったからである。
As mentioned above, the glaze 5 on the front end surface 3a of the curved portion 3 is wiped off when the glaze 5 is attached to the front end surface 3a, and the glaze 5 straddles the front end surface 3a due to the action of surface tension. Since the pixel base 1 is fired in such a state, the fired glaze 5 causes the pixel base 1 to become connected at the tip surface 3a, and therefore, the fired multi-pixel base 1 must be separated, but at that time, the glaze in the connected state may be damaged. This is because the glaze 5 often extends to the glaze 5 layer of the curved portion 3.

しかしながら、先端面3aの釉薬5のローラ等による払
拭は常に完全に行なわれるものではなく、不完全なこと
も間々あり、僅かの釉薬5が先端面3aに残溜していた
ため、結局上記の如く、素地1同志が連結してしまうと
いうことが多かった。
However, the wiping of the glaze 5 on the tip surface 3a by a roller or the like is not always done completely, and is sometimes incomplete, and a small amount of the glaze 5 remains on the tip surface 3a, resulting in the above-mentioned situation. , there were many cases in which comrades with 1 base were connected.

内幅木人隅等の内幅水についても同様のことが言える。The same thing can be said about the inner width of the inner baseboard corner.

この考案は上記の欠点を解決するためになされたもので
ある。
This invention was made to solve the above-mentioned drawbacks.

以下にこの考案を図面に示す実施例に従って説明する。This invention will be explained below according to embodiments shown in the drawings.

第2図乃至第4図において、第1図の部材と同一の部材
は、第1図に示される符号と同一の符号で示されている
In FIGS. 2 to 4, the same members as those in FIG. 1 are designated by the same reference numerals as shown in FIG.

陶磁製、セメント製5合戊樹脂製。金属製等の素地1の
湾曲部3の先端面3aには、該素地1に施される釉薬5
の層の厚みの2倍よりもやや大きめに突出した一対の小
凸起6,6が一体形成されている。
Made of ceramic, cement, 5-ply resin. A glaze 5 applied to the base 1 is applied to the tip surface 3a of the curved portion 3 of the base 1 made of metal or the like.
A pair of small protrusions 6, 6 protruding slightly larger than twice the thickness of the layer are integrally formed.

例えば、釉薬5の層の厚みが0゜23mmである場合、
小凸起6,6ノ高さは、0.5mm程度となる。
For example, if the thickness of the glaze 5 layer is 0°23 mm,
The height of the small protrusions 6, 6 is approximately 0.5 mm.

これらの小凸起6,6間中心線C1は、素地1を対称な
形に2分割する中心線C2に対して、小凸起6,6の幅
Wの2分の1より大きい値だけずれている。
The center line C1 between these small protrusions 6, 6 deviates from the center line C2 that symmetrically divides the substrate 1 into two by a value larger than half of the width W of the small protrusions 6, 6. ing.

それは、2つの素地1の湾曲部3の先端面3a同志を突
き合わせた際、小凸起6,6同志が突き当たらない様に
するためである。
This is to prevent the small protrusions 6, 6 from coming into contact with each other when the tip surfaces 3a of the curved portions 3 of the two base materials 1 are butted against each other.

しかし小凸起6,6同志が突き当たる様に雨中心線CI
However, the rain center line CI appears as if the small bumps 6 and 6 are hitting each other.
.

C2を一致させる場合もある。In some cases, C2 may be matched.

このような場合、小凸起6の高さは、釉薬5の層の厚み
より大きければよい。
In such a case, the height of the small protrusions 6 only needs to be greater than the thickness of the glaze 5 layer.

この実施例のタイル素地1は、従来のタイル素地と同様
の方法で焼成される。
The tile blank 1 of this example is fired in the same manner as conventional tile blanks.

第5図は、本考案を内幅木人隅に応用した実施例を示し
、素地11の平坦部12の一側辺の湾曲部13の先端面
13 aに一対の小凸起16.16が一体形成されてい
る。
FIG. 5 shows an embodiment in which the present invention is applied to an inner baseboard corner, in which a pair of small protrusions 16.16 are formed on the tip surface 13a of the curved portion 13 on one side of the flat portion 12 of the base material 11. It is integrally formed.

第6図は、本考案を内幅木片面取に応用した場合の実施
例を示しており、素地21の湾曲部23の先端面23
aに一対の小凸起26.26が一体に形成されている。
FIG. 6 shows an embodiment in which the present invention is applied to a single chamfer of an inner skirting board, and shows the tip surface 23 of the curved portion 23 of the base material 21.
A pair of small protrusions 26, 26 are integrally formed on a.

第7図は、本考案を内幅木片面取出隅に応用した実施例
を示すもので、素地31の湾曲部33の先端面33 a
に一対の小凸起36.36が一体に形成されている。
FIG. 7 shows an embodiment in which the present invention is applied to a single-sided corner of an inner skirting board.
A pair of small protrusions 36, 36 are integrally formed on the.

小凸起の数は、2個に限定されるものでなく、1個又は
3個以上でも良い。
The number of small protrusions is not limited to two, and may be one or three or more.

しかし2個以上小凸起を設ける場合は、金型の小凸起用
穴の全部が詰らない限り、少なくとも1個の小凸起を確
実に形成出来る利点があると共に、匣詰の際、対となる
一方の素地を従来品としても、両者の湾曲部先端の間隙
が一様に保たれるという利点がある。
However, when providing two or more small protrusions, there is an advantage that at least one small protrusion can be reliably formed as long as all of the holes for small protrusions in the mold are not clogged. Even if one of the base materials used is a conventional product, there is an advantage that the gap between the tips of the curved portions of both can be kept uniform.

上記の次第で、この考案によれば、素地の湾曲部先端面
に、少なくとも1個の小凸起が形成されているものであ
るから、素地の施釉後、焼成のため一対の素地の施釉面
同志を向かい合わせると共に、湾曲部先端面同志を突き
合わせた際、先端面間に間隙が生じるものであるから、
例え先端面に釉薬が残溜していたとしても、釉薬が他方
の先端面に接触したり、また釉薬同志が接触したりする
ことを防止し得るという効果がある。
According to the above, according to this invention, at least one small protrusion is formed on the tip surface of the curved part of the base material, so that after the base material is glazed, the glazed surfaces of the pair of base materials are used for firing. When the two curved portions face each other and the tip surfaces of the curved portions butt each other, a gap is created between the tip surfaces.
Even if glaze remains on the tip surface, it is effective in preventing the glaze from contacting the other tip surface or from contacting each other.

従って、冒頭記載の欠点、すなわち、湾曲部先端面間に
跨った状態で存在する釉薬により、画素地が焼着し、そ
れらを引き離した際、湾曲部の釉薬層が破損するという
欠点を除くことが出来る。
Therefore, it is possible to eliminate the drawback mentioned at the beginning, that is, the pixel base is baked due to the glaze existing between the tip surfaces of the curved part, and when they are separated, the glaze layer on the curved part is damaged. I can do it.

また例え小凸起が他方の湾曲部先端に残溜する釉薬と接
触したとしても、小凸起であるため、該接触面積が極端
に小さく、従って画素地が焼着したとしても、両者を容
易に分離することが出来るため、湾曲部の釉薬層を釉損
することがない。
Furthermore, even if the small protrusion comes into contact with the glaze remaining at the tip of the other curved part, since it is a small protrusion, the contact area is extremely small, so even if the pixel base is baked, it is easy to separate both Since it can be separated into two parts, the glaze layer on the curved part will not be damaged.
